Evers Campaign Ad Has Former Secretary Talking About Lincoln Hills

Wisconsin Department of Corrections

The gloves have come off in the election campaign even before Democrats pick a candidate to challenge Governor Scott Walker.

Democrat Tony Evers has released a campaign ad featuring Walker's former Department of Corrections Chief Ed Wall. Wall alleges Walker's staff was aware of the conditions at Lincoln Hills and Copper Lake in Lincoln county long before they admitted it publically.

Here's some audio from the Evers campaign ad on it's You Tube channel...

"....My name is Ed Wall. I was Gov. Scott Walkers cabinet Secretary for the Dept. of Corrections. We put multiple plans in front of Gov. Scott Walker's staff on how to address the issues at Lincoln Hills and they didn't want to deal with it. Scott Walker completely mismanaged the issues at Lincoln Hills. It was strongly suggested to cabinet secretaries that we not create written records. No paper trails..."

Wall is supporting Evers bid to be Governor.

In January Gov. Walker announced the closing of Lincoln Hills and said a number of regional juvenile detention facilities would be built.

Lincoln Hills has been the focus of a federal and other investigations. Several lawsuits have been filed against the state.

We contacted Gov.  Walker's campaign for reaction but have not heard back.
